It is our intent that our Music curriculum engages and inspires pupils to develop a love of music and their talent as musicians. As pupils progress, they should develop a critical engagement with music from a wide range of traditions and historical periods, allowing them to compose, practise and perform thus increasing their self-confidence, creativity and sense of achievement.

We strive to ensure our children experience a breadth of live music and the joy this bring.  We have at least one live multicultural music performance in school each year and Y4,5 & 6 also go to the BridgeWater Hall each year to experience the Halle Orchestra Live!

Our choir also performs each year at Bolton Schools Music Festival.
